I just was looking around for a nice notepad++ alternative and found brackets which is a project by adobe and damn it's fast and handy!

It's currently work in progress but can already be downloaded at http://brackets.io/ for Mac and Windows.

The main features are: live results in google chrome* and it being fully open source and written in html, js and css.

*Google chrome is only supported at this moment which is the only major downside at the moment.

It also supports less files which are advanced css files which is how I found out about brackets after searching a editor that supported less files by default :p
